Natalie's Score: 94/100

From Napa Valley, a concentrated and juicy blend of 85% Cabernet Sauvignon, 10% Merlot and 5% Petit Verdot, of which a portion is aged in new French oak barriques. Dark ruby in the glass with cassis, liquid blueberry, earthy florals, cedar spice and smoky vanilla flavours on the palate. Tannins are fine and velvety. Drink or hold.

Cabernet Sauvignon food pairings: slow-braised lamb shanks, venison stew, pork roast.

Jennifer Havers - WSET Level 3 rated this wine as 92/100 with the following review:

Lovely and bold Cabernet Sauvignon with aromas of currant, black berry, woodsmoke, eucalyptus and warm spice. Full bodied and smooth on the palate, with soft but structured tannins with ripe dark berry fruit, spice, and hints of smoke on the finish. Enjoy with grilled meats.
Tarot 2016 Cabernet Sauvignon is a rich blend of 85% Cabernet Sauvignon, 10% Merlot and 5% Petit Verdot aged 20 months in 34% new French oak. Deep ruby-purple in the glass with ripe black currant, blueberry, blackberry and mint finishing smoky and spicy on the palate. Tannins are fine-grained. Pour with a juicy grilled hangar steak. - Community Wine Reviews
